Kyrgyzstan`s zero trust security market offers cybersecurity solutions and frameworks based on the zero trust model, assuming no implicit trust in users, devices, or networks, enhancing security posture and resilience against cyber threats.
The increasing cybersecurity threats and data breaches drive demand for zero trust security solutions in Kyrgyzstan. With a focus on continuous authentication and access controls, zero trust security frameworks offer enhanced protection against cyber threats, driving market adoption.
Challenges in the Kyrgyzstan zero trust security market include limited awareness about cybersecurity threats and the benefits of zero trust architecture. Moreover, the lack of skilled cybersecurity professionals and regulatory constraints impact market adoption rates.
Kyrgyzstan`s government has prioritized cybersecurity through policies promoting the adoption of zero trust security frameworks in public and private sectors. These policies include cybersecurity awareness programs, regulatory compliance requirements, and support for technological innovations to mitigate cyber threats and safeguard critical infrastructure.
